The rural retro decor style is a nod to the past, featuring elements that are rich in history and culture. It draws inspiration from the natural surroundings of rural life, incorporating materials like wood, stone, and other natural fibers. The use of these materials not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also provides a sense of warmth and comfort.

One of the most prominent features of rural retro decor is the use of antique furniture. These pieces are not just pieces of furniture but are a testament to the craftsmanship and history of a particular era. From old-fashioned wooden tables to hand-carved chairs, every piece tells a story. These furniture pieces are often restored to their original glory, retaining their charm and character.

Another key aspect is the use of traditional lighting fixtures. The use of lamps and lanterns made from natural materials like bamboo and wood adds a cozy and inviting touch to any space. These lighting fixtures not only provide illumination but also create a warm and relaxing ambiance.

The color palette in rural retro decor is often warm and earthy, featuring hues of red, brown, beige, and gray. These colors are often found in nature, giving the space a sense of harmony and balance. The use of these colors also provides a sense of warmth and comfort, making the space feel like home.

Moreover, rural retro decor emphasizes the use of accessories and decorations that reflect rural life. This includes the use of vintage tools, agricultural implements, and other objects that hold historical significance. These objects not only add visual interest but also provide a connection to the past, creating a narrative for the home.
